Job description

Position Title

Registered Nurse (RN) Operating Room Lead

Location

Main OR – St Lukes Medical Center

Department

Surgical Services / Operating Room

Schedule

Monday through Friday, Day shift, 8 hour shifts, 40 hours per week. Full time. FTE 1.0 or 0.9.

Salary Range

$41,100 – $61,650

Position Overview

We are seeking an experienced RN Operating Room Lead to provide clinical leadership and operational oversight within our surgical services department. This role is responsible for coordinating daily operations, supporting staff, and ensuring the delivery of safe, high-quality patient care in a fast-paced perioperative environment. The ideal candidate is a strong clinical leader who can balance patient care responsibilities with team coordination and resource management.

Responsibilities
  • Manages supplies & equipment.
  • Oversees daily operations.
  • Coordinates staffing, assignments, and resources to support surgical procedures and departmental operations.
  • Provides daily work direction to clinical and support staff to ensure efficient workflow and optimal patient throughput.
  • Delivers direct patient care utilizing the nursing process, including assessment, planning, implementation, and evaluation.
  • Promotes a safe, therapeutic, and patient-centered environment through active rounding and quality oversight.
  • Facilitates effective communication among interdisciplinary team members, patients, and families.
  • Addresses service concerns and supports resolution efforts to improve patient and staff experience.
  • Serves as a clinical resource, providing guidance, training, and orientation to team members.
  • Monitors staff performance, provides feedback, and collaborates with leadership on performance evaluations.
  • Assists with hiring processes, employee engagement, and conflict resolution as needed.
  • Evaluates staffing levels and productivity needs; adjusts assignments to meet patient and departmental demands.
  • Maintains staff schedules and ensures appropriate coverage.
  • Monitors patient care quality and ensures adherence to organizational policies, nursing standards, and regulatory requirements.
  • Participates in quality improvement initiatives and peer review processes.
  • Supports budget planning and ensures adequate supplies, equipment, and inventory.
  • Collaborates with vendors, participates in product evaluations, and coordinates equipment training.
  • Assists leadership in developing and enhancing programs and services.
  • Provides age-appropriate care across the lifespan, demonstrating understanding of growth and development principles.
  • Assesses and interprets patient data to deliver individualized care aligned with departmental standards.
